Drawer Assembly For An Oven Appliance

A drawer assembly for an oven appliance is provided. The drawer assembly includes two slide assemblies mounted within a cooking chamber of the oven appliance for supporting a door and a rack assembly. The rack assembly includes a wire support frame for supporting a cooking tray and two support brackets for mounting the wire support frame to the slide assemblies. In this manner, a user may slide the rack assembly and cooking tray out of the cooking chamber by pulling on the door. The wire support frame may be formed from metal using computer numerically controlled machining and may be welded to the support brackets. In this manner, the rack assembly provides a simple, rigid construction that requires a minimal number of parts and is easy to manufacture.

COOKING SYSTEM
20170164787 · 2017-06-15 ·

A cooking system providing eight different cooking methods through one cooking device is provided. The cooking device has a plurality of walls forming an enclosure space therein, wherein the enclosure space is accessible by an opening. The lower portion of the cooking device has adjustable heating elements for enabling the enclosure space to be used as a boiler pot, steamer pot or low heat simmer stew pot. The enclosure space is also adapted to removably, separately and operably retain a charcoal liner, a deep fryer basket, or a Cajun microwave, thereby embodying a method for providing at least eight different cooking methods through the cooking device.
